Nestled on 750 acres of pine and cypress forest, The Cabins at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ort – A Disney Vacation Club Resort evokes the timeless beauty of the American frontier. Each morning you can let the magic of the outdoors shine through as you draw the curtains back to reveal floor-to-ceiling windows. Luxuriate in accommodations that provide a fresh, elevated take on the cabin experience—with a fully equipped kitchen, large flat-screen TVs and additional comforts and conveniences.

The newly remodeled cabins are generally praised for their modern design and amenities, though some customers miss the rustic charm of the old cabins.
Service Issues
Several reviews highlight inconsistent service, including long wait times for maintenance and check-in, as well as issues with housekeeping.
Transportation
Guests appreciate the convenient transportation options, including buses and boats to the parks, but some recommend renting a golf cart for easier navigation.
Pricing Concerns
Many customers feel that the pricing is high for the value received, with some expressing dissatisfaction over additional fees and the overall cost of the stay.
Cleanliness
While some guests found the cabins clean and well-maintained, others reported issues with cleanliness upon check-in.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ort
What types of accommodations does The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ort offer?
The resort offers cabin accommodations designed to evoke the American frontier, featuring fully equipped kitchens, large flat-screen TVs, and additional comforts to enhance your stay.
Are pets allowed at The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ort?
Yes, dogs are welcome at the resort, although cats are not allowed.
Is parking available at The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ort, and is it free?
Yes, both self-parking and valet parking are available for free at the resort.
Does the resort provide swimming pools and are they indoor or outdoor?
The resort has outdoor swimming pools available, but there are no indoor pools.
Is The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ort suitable for families with children?
Yes, the resort is kid-friendly and provides amenities suitable for families.
Is there a bar available on the premises at The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ort?
Yes, the resort features a bar for guests to enjoy.
Does The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ort offer shuttle services for guests?
Yes, the resort provides a local shuttle service for guests' convenience.
Where can I find dining options near The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ort?
Nearby dining options include Trail's End Restaurant, Crockett's Tavern, Mickey's Backyard BBQ, and Meadow Snack Bar, all offering various meals and family-friendly atmospheres.
Are there entertainment venues close to The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ort?
Yes, the Hoop-Dee-Doo Musical Revue is a nearby dinner theater providing a unique and lively entertainment experience.
How can nearby transit locations help guests visiting The Cabins at Disney's Fort Wilderness Resort?
Guests can use the Outpost Bus Stop nearby for convenient access to transportation around the resort and the greater Walt Disney World area, facilitating easy travel during their stay.
